ckeditor+ckfinderが画像のアップロードを実現したとき、中国語の名前付き画像のアップロードエラー
869 ワード
配列やアルファベット名の画像は正常にアップロードできますが、中国語名の画像のアップロードでエラーが発生し、画像名の中の中国語がurlencode()を通過しているように見えます.仕方なく画像の名前を変更する方法は以下の通りです.
1.ckfindercoreconnectorphpphp 5CommandHandlerFileUpload.phpの51行目、$uploadedFile=array_を見つけます.shift($_FILES);行コード、下に画像の名前を変更するコードを追加します.
2.保存すればいいです.
1.ckfindercoreconnectorphpphp 5CommandHandlerFileUpload.phpの51行目、$uploadedFile=array_を見つけます.shift($_FILES);行コード、下に画像の名前を変更するコードを追加します.
1 //
2 $p = explode(".",$uploadedFile['name']);
3 $p = "cf".time().".".$p[1];
2.保存すればいいです.